Violent offending in severe mental illness: the role of psychiatric comorbidity and crime type - insights from the first nationwide Norwegian registry linkage
2026-07-14
Abstract excerpt
<h4>Background</h4> Individuals with severe mental illness (SMI), including schizophrenia spectrum disorders (SSD) and bipolar disorder (BD), have been shown to have an elevated risk of violent perpetration.
